logstash是一个开源的数据收集引擎,用于将不同来源的数据进行收集、转换和传输。它可以从各种数据源(如文件、数据库、消息队列等)中获取数据,并将其发送到不同的目标(如Elasticsearch、Kafka等)进行处理和存储。
在logstash配置中使用kafka作为输入插件,可以实现从kafka主题中消费数据。配置中需要指定kafka的相关参数,如kafka的地址、主题名称、消费者组等。通过配置合适的过滤器,可以对从kafka中获取的数据进行处理和转换,以满足特定的需求。
同时,通过配置输出插件将数据发送到Elasticsearch(ES),可以实现数据的索引和搜索功能。ES是一个分布式的搜索和分析引擎,可以快速地存储、搜索和分析大量的数据。在logstash配置中,需要指定ES的地址、索引名称等参数,以及定义数据的映射关系。
logstash配置中的kafka并将输出发送到ES的应用场景包括:
腾讯云提供了一系列与logstash相关的产品和服务,包括:
更多关于腾讯云相关产品和服务的介绍,请参考腾讯云官方网站:https://cloud.tencent.com/
领取专属 10元无门槛券
手把手带您无忧上云